CVE-2024-29041

Description

A flaw was found in the Express.js minimalist web framework for node. Upstream versions of Express.js before 4.19.0 and all pre-release alpha and beta versions of 5.0 are affected by an open redirect vulnerability using malformed URLs. When a user of Express performs a redirect using a user-provided URL, Express performs an encode using encodeurl on the contents before passing it to the location header. This issue can cause malformed URLs to be evaluated in unexpected ways by common redirect allow list implementations in Express applications, leading to an Open Redirect via bypass of a properly implemented allow list. The main method impacted is res.location(), but this is also called from within res.redirect(). The vulnerability is fixed in upstream version 4.19.2 and 5.0.0-beta.3.

Statement

Red Hat Fuse 7 only uses express as part of build time development dependency, it is not part of the final product delivery.

Upstream versions should not be relied upon for ultimate determination of affectedness. Red Hat might backport fixes from upstream versions on a case by case basis.

Mitigation

Red Hat has investigated whether a possible mitigation exists for this issue, and has not been able to identify a practical example. Please update the affected package as soon as possible.

Understanding the Weakness (CWE)

Access Control

Technical Impact: Bypass Protection Mechanism; Gain Privileges or Assume Identity

The user may be redirected to an untrusted page that contains malware which may then compromise the user's system. In some cases, an open redirect can also enable the immediate download of a file without the user's permission, because the redirection to an external site may lead to endpoints on those sites that automatically trigger a download action ("drive-by download" [REF-1478]). This will expose the user to extensive risk. The user's interaction with the web server may also be compromised if the malware conducts keylogging or other attacks that steal credentials, personally identifiable information (PII), or other important data.

Access Control,Confidentiality,Other

Technical Impact: Bypass Protection Mechanism; Gain Privileges or Assume Identity; Other

By modifying the URL value to a malicious site, an attacker may successfully launch a phishing scam. The user may be subjected to phishing attacks by being redirected to an untrusted page. The phishing attack may point to an attacker controlled web page that appears to be a trusted web site. The phishers may then steal the user's credentials and then use these credentials to access the legitimate web site. Because the server name in the modified link is identical to the original site, phishing attempts have a more trustworthy appearance.
